Output 7a593275200d7ef76b1c9cd8c0da4efdbf4a69aed27b59d99acad2dd5a54582b:0

value
338800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d95dc725bd5cec447b5154933951f7c97b810d36 OP_EQUAL
address
3MWLtyWHWjeNnT49rH4iySy9BC1WF41heb
transaction
7a593275200d7ef76b1c9cd8c0da4efdbf4a69aed27b59d99acad2dd5a54582b
spent
true